The cornices that crown two of the walls are in two layers; a bottom layer of some type of pulpboard material and the top layer of laser board. I painted the bottom layer with the Mustard Yellow and the top with the Vintage White. The inlays on the bottom layer were keftraw. Then it's a simple matter of sandwiching the two layers and weighting to dry. Then some sponge-dabbing to weather them a bit.
